// Per-tenant rate quotas are enforced by the Quotarium service, not locally.
// Each client instance pulls its tenant's quota config at startup and
// refreshes every 60s. Do not hardcode limits here — stale values cause
// spurious 429s when quotas are raised. The client fails closed: if
// Quotarium is unreachable, requests are throttled to the floor tier.
// Setup requires the tenant slug, the quota region, and the internal
// service key, which is provided on the next line.

service key, tadup-tahog: zpat7_wB1tnEL

Capacity note: Hollowfen admin dashboard dark-mode rollout.

Theme assets double the CSS bundle temporarily since both palettes ship until the flag GA's. Expect CDN egress up roughly a third for two weeks; origin load unchanged. Theme-preference writes add a small steady stream to the settings service — within headroom, but watch write latency during the Monday admin rush. No new alerts planned; existing dashboards cover it. Cache TTLs and prefetch limits governing asset delivery are set below.

tuning constants:
QUOTAS = {
    "druwyn": 5,
    "holix": 5,
    "zorath": 5,
    "holwyn": 10,
}

Ticket: QUILLMETRIC-array sidecar fails signature check on v2.4 rollout. Aggregator pods reject the sidecar image post-rotation; old key still cached in node trust store. Fix: flush trust cache, redeploy with rotated material. Blocking canary in the Harlow cluster. Verify images against the current signing key, shown below:

rollout seal: bky4_DFM9